Transaction 0695235f3acdb24ef650841c3d8f473c2ca38d761d2c30bcc90dad41c119696f
1 Input
1 Output
-
0695235f3acdb24ef650841c3d8f473c2ca38d761d2c30bcc90dad41c119696f:0
- value
- 699994104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acd0709379fdf93b8ed7ca1d0efffa0e036c26de OP_EQUAL
- address
- 3HSmrBm5ySWCoAjtXAPvfqMkDUSJX5J5CY